I suggest you try reseating the ROM DIMM. It may
take more force than you might expect to get it to
"click" into place.
I did insert it many times; even alternating it back
and forth with rev A & B and rev A consistly worked
whereas Rev B did not. Strange.
There's not much to go wrong with those ROM modules.
snip all the other seemingly good to try points below.
But my I suggest, that you try resetting OpenFirmware whenever
swapping the ROM chips. I don't 'member them and have them yet
on another drive not available now, but something along the
lines of; booting up holding the Cmd+Opt+O+F keys and at the OF
prompt type: reset-nvram and hit return, then type: reset-all
and hit return, then quite likely your Mac should reboot and
hopefully all will then be good to go. I am hoping that one
of our Gurus will now fill Us in on those needed OF Command
corrections. Hope that this helps in some small way.
